Branch Boulevard at 4920 Old Pineville, LLC 2100 Hastings Drive Charlotte, NC 28207 Chris.Branch@blvdrea.com Subject: Conclusion of Brownfields Agreement Process Blythe Isenhour 4920 Old Pineville Road Charlotte, Mecklenburg County Brownfields Project Number 23067-19-060 Dear Mr. Branch: We are very pleased that the Brownfields Agreement process regarding this project is approaching its successful conclusion. To that end, please find enclosed the Notice of Brownfields Property (Notice), the Brownfields Agreement (Agreement) and the plat for this Brownfields Property certified by the North Carolina Department of Environmental Quality (DEQ) via the signature of Michael Scott, Director of the Division of Waste Management. Please promptly have all necessary parties on the Prospective Developers’ side of the transaction sign the Notice and the Agreement. Please note that the Prospective Developer’s signature on the Notice requires notarization. Please file the documents for recordation with the Register of Deeds of Mecklenburg County. Documents to be recorded are: • The Notice of Brownfields Property (signed and notarized); o Exhibit A (signed Brownfields Agreement); • Exhibit 1 (Site Location Map); • Exhibit 2 (Data Tables); o Exhibit B (8 ½ x 11-inch Reduction of the Survey Plat); o Exhibit C (Legal Description); and • Full-sized approved mylar survey plat (signed by DEQ). NCGS § 130A-310.35(b) requires filing of the Notice within 15 days of Prospective Developer’s receipt of DEQ’s approval of the Notice or Prospective Developer’s entry into the Brownfields Agreement, whichever is later. Blythe Isenhour November 23, 2021 Page 2 You are responsible for obtaining the Register of Deeds stamp at the top of the Notice’s first page with the Book and Page numbers where both the Notice and the plat are recorded. Upon your filing of the Notice, the register of deeds is required by NCGS § 130A-310.35(c) to record and index it in the grantor index under the names of the owners of the land and, if different, also under the name of the Prospective Developer. Pursuant to paragraph 17 of the Agreement, as required by statute, within three (3) days after the Register of Deeds has recorded the Notice of Brownfields Property, you shall furnish DEQ with a copy of the Notice containing the certification by the register of deeds as to the Book and Page numbers where both the Notice and the plat are recorded, and a copy of the actual, full-sized plat with notations by the register of deeds indicating its recordation. Please note that it is not necessary to send a mylar version of the recorded plat to the Brownfields Program. Make sure that the exhibits to the Notice are attached to the certified copy you furnish DEQ. Please send these items to: Ms. Shirley Liggins NC Department of Environmental Quality Division of Waste Management Brownfields Program Mail Service Center 1646 Raleigh, NC 27699-1646 Electronic submittal of the certified copies is also an acceptable means to satisfy this requirement. Such submittals should be sent to Shirley.liggins@ncdenr.gov and to peter.doorn@ncdenr.gov.
